About the job
OECD is hiring a Security Systems and Networks Specialist to help safeguard its technology infrastructure. The role centers on implementing and managing security systems across a variety of network environments. The main objective is to protect the safety and integrity of the organization’s information systems.
Main responsibilities
Implement and manage security systems for different network setups
Monitor information systems to ensure their integrity
Apply cybersecurity principles and recognized best practices in daily work
Support secure communication and data protection by working with network protocols
Requirements
Solid understanding of cybersecurity concepts
Experience working with network protocols
Familiarity with established security best practices
This position is located in Paris.

Your RoleIn Brief:You will take ownership of our security compliance program (ISO 27001) within the QARA (Quality, Assurance & Regulatory Affairs) team.Your mission is to lead our Information Security Management System (ISMS) and ensure alignment with the existing quality management system (QMS). This role focuses on GRC/security compliance with a health sensitivity: you will interpret regulatory requirements related to security, collaborate closely with your colleagues and the Security Manager, while remaining deeply rooted in your expertise.Your Impact:You will drive Resilience's growth in regulated markets (healthcare, sensitive data) by ensuring our security posture and maintaining credibility with clients, partners, and authorities.Your Daily Responsibilities:Lead and automate the ISO 27001 ISMS: Full ownership of the ISO 27001 program integrated into the QMS — controls, risk register, policies, internal audits, corrective actions. Build and enhance automation workflows (Notion, AI agents, reporting) to remain audit-ready at all times.Interface between ISMS and medical device cybersecurity: Ensure coherence between ISMS and QMS, support cybersecurity requirements for medical devices (IEC 81001-5-1, IEC 62443, SBOM, MDR Annex I §17) in collaboration with the QARA team, contribute to technical files and audits on security aspects, assist with the security gap assessment for DiGA (BSI TR-03161), and maintain FDA cybersecurity monitoring.Prepare for new regulatory frameworks: Anticipate and translate NIS2, HIPAA, SOC2 requirements into pragmatic controls and concrete deliverables. Position OverviewWe are seeking a dedicated Risk Prevention Specialist (IPRP) to join our multidisciplinary team at Prévenir, an innovative SPSTI that supports approximately 14,000 workers in Île-de-France. This role is based at our center located at 117 quai de Valmy, 75010 Paris, and involves both fieldwork (Workplace Actions) and remote activities (via video conferencing and webinars).Your mission is to play a crucial role in enhancing health and safety in the workplace by assisting our member companies in evaluating, prioritizing, and mitigating professional risks. Key ResponsibilitiesConduct Workplace Actions (AMT): company visits and observations, job studies, and information gathering (activity, workforce, organization, roles, processes, products, equipment, exposures, occupational accidents, etc.).Develop and update company risk profiles and assist in risk assessment procedures (DUERP, prevention plans, safety registers, etc.).Identify, analyze, and prioritize risks: physical, chemical, biological, ergonomic, psychosocial, organizational (e.g., MSDs, falls, noise, vibrations, handling, fire/explosion, road risks).Provide prevention recommendations based on the hierarchy of controls: eliminate → substitute → collective protections → organization.Assist in building and prioritizing a realistic action plan (short/medium term) tailored to the company's resources, and monitor its implementation (indicators, continuous improvement).Conduct awareness sessions and training on safety and prevention topics.Participate in works council meetings and contribute to investigations following accidents (as needed).Contribute to SPSTI collective actions: prevention campaigns, workshops, webinars, and feedback sessions.Guide companies to external resources if necessary (CARSAT/CRAMIF, INRS, ANACT/ARACT, labor inspection, control agencies, specialized consultants), in collaboration with the SPSTI.
